Measure

The word "measure" originates from the Latin "metiri", meaning to measure. It highlights humanity's longstanding desire to quantify and understand the world.

Centerpiece

"Centerpiece" derives from Middle English "centre" and "piece". It emphasizes a focal point, often in artistic arrangements, reflecting balance and significance.

Centre

"The term "centre" comes from the Latin "centrum", meaning the midpoint. This root illustrates its role in geometry and spatial relationships throughout history.
